Although a lot of conspiracy branded stuff is indeed often self projected and reinforced by others susceptible to it, it doesnt mean that you can instantly dismiss the validity of a lot of the 'bad' stuff that is happening and is being covered up and labeled as conspiracy.
It's way too easy for people to just reach for the 'delusional' stamp 'if someone mentions anything conspiracy related. Just cos a lot of people seem paranoid, doesn't mean they don't have reason to be. even if the logic that got them there is misplaced. in some cases, but not all, dedicating large ammounts of time into researching and reinforcing the anti conspiracy route is exactly the same kind of distraction conspiracy theorist is hunting.
Either way, i think both the people engulfed in conspiracy, and the people that swear blindly that 'its all in your head, man' should spend their energy more effetcively, and gain a better perspective on the appalling things that happen virtually right in front us, every day.
It's odd (maybe not) how conspiracy gains more popularity than the clear injustices that exist pretty much unclouded.
What are we gonna do about it though?.. Talk about it on the internet some more and try to validate our own opinions and hope it all works out
